Course Content

Immigration Law Basics for Non-Profits: Understanding core immigration statutes and regulations relevant to assisting immigrant communities.
Working with Vulnerable Populations: Ethics, cultural competency, and trauma-informed approaches in immigration legal services.
Due Process & Asylum Law: Navigating the asylum process, including credible fear interviews and affirmative asylum applications. (Keywords: Asylum Law, Credible Fear)
Deportation Defense & Removal Proceedings: Representing clients in immigration court, including waivers and cancellation of removal.
Family-Based Immigration: Petitions for relatives, including spouses, children, and parents. (Keywords: Family Immigration, Green Card)
Employment-Based Immigration: H-1B visas, green cards for skilled workers, and other employment-based immigration options.
Immigration Relief for Victims of Crime: U-visas and T-visas for victims of human trafficking and other crimes.
Effective Advocacy & Communication: Strategies for working with government agencies, community outreach, and client communication.
Legal Ethics and Professional Responsibility for immigration practitioners in a non-profit setting.

Career path

Career Role (Immigration Law) Description
Immigration Caseworker/Paralegal Supports solicitors, handling administrative tasks, client communication, and case preparation. High demand for detail-oriented professionals with strong organizational skills.
Immigration Solicitor/Lawyer Provides legal advice and representation to clients navigating UK immigration laws. Requires a law degree and relevant experience. Excellent career prospects and high earning potential.
Immigration Consultant Advises clients on immigration matters, providing guidance on visa applications and related processes. In-depth knowledge of UK immigration policies is essential.
